Career path

Job Role (Smart Factory Analytics) Description
Data Analyst (Smart Manufacturing) Analyze production data to optimize processes and improve efficiency. Key skills: Data visualization, SQL, Python.
Industrial IoT (IIoT) Engineer Develop and maintain IIoT systems, collecting and analyzing data from factory sensors. Expertise in cloud platforms (AWS, Azure) essential.
Predictive Maintenance Specialist Leverage machine learning to predict equipment failures and schedule preventative maintenance, minimizing downtime. Strong analytics and programming skills are crucial.
Smart Factory Consultant Advise companies on implementing smart factory technologies, providing analytics solutions and strategic guidance. Requires experience with various industrial automation systems.
